Central Christian College vs. York College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Central Christian College or York College?

  • York College is 2.8% more expensive to attend than Central Christian College for in-state tuition ($20,450.00 vs. $19,900.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 2.8% higher at York College than Central Christian College of Kansas ($20,450.00 vs. $19,900.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Central Christian College of Kansas than York College ($15,732 vs. $17,835)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Central Christian College of Kansas are 12.5% lower than costs at York College ($8,000 vs. $9,000)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at York College than Central Christian College of Kansas (100% vs. 96%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Central Christian College of Kansas students is 25.6% larger than aid received York College ($17,158 vs. $13,665)

Central Christian College vs. York College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Central Christian College or York College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between York College and Central Christian College.

  • The graduation rate at Central Christian College is higher than York College (41% vs. 31%)
  • Graduates from York College earn on average $5,700 more per year than Central Christian College graduates after ten years. ($38,300 vs. $32,600)
  • Central Christian College of Kansas students graduate with a $1,000 lower median federal student loan debt than York College graduates. ($25,000 vs. $26,000)
  • Central Christian College graduates are paying $10 less per month on federal student loans than York College graduates. ($258 vs. $268)
  • More York College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Central Christian College students, three years after graduation. (57% vs. 43%)
